||||||
|
DGL compatibility
|
||||||
|
********************************************************************************
|
||||||
|
|
||||||
|
Deep Graph Library `(DGL) <https://www.dgl.ai/>`_ is an easy-to-use, high-performance and scalable
|
||||||
|
Python package for deep learning on graphs. DGL is framework agnostic, meaning
|
||||||
|
if a deep graph model is a component in an end-to-end application, the rest of
|
||||||
|
the logic is implemented using PyTorch.
|
||||||
|
|
||||||
|
* ROCm support for DGL is hosted in the `https://github.com/ROCm/dgl <https://github.com/ROCm/dgl>`_ repository.
|
||||||
|
* Due to independent compatibility considerations, this location differs from the `https://github.com/dmlc/dgl <https://github.com/dmlc/dgl>`_ upstream repository.
|
||||||
|
* Use the prebuilt :ref:`Docker images <dgl-docker-compat>` with DGL, PyTorch, and ROCm preinstalled.
|
||||||
|
* See the :doc:`ROCm DGL installation guide <rocm-install-on-linux:install/3rd-party/dgl-install>`
|
||||||
|
to install and get started.

|
||||||
|
Key ROCm libraries for DGL
|
||||||
|
================================================================================
|
||||||
|
|
||||||
|
DGL on ROCm depends on specific libraries that affect its features and performance.
|
||||||
|
Using the DGL Docker container or building it with the provided docker file or a ROCm base image is recommended.
|
||||||
|
If you prefer to build it yourself, ensure the following dependencies are installed:
|
||||||
|
|
||||||
|
.. list-table::
|
||||||
|
:header-rows: 1
|
||||||
|
|
||||||
|
* - ROCm library
|
||||||
|
- Version
|
||||||
|
- Purpose
|
||||||
|
* - `Composable Kernel <https://github.com/ROCm/composable_kernel>`_
|
||||||
|
- :version-ref:`"Composable Kernel" rocm_version`
|
||||||
|
- Enables faster execution of core operations like matrix multiplication
|
||||||
|
(GEMM), convolutions and transformations.
|
||||||
|
* - `hipBLAS <https://github.com/ROCm/hipBLAS>`_
|
||||||
|
- :version-ref:`hipBLAS rocm_version`
|
||||||
|
- Provides GPU-accelerated Basic Linear Algebra Subprograms (BLAS) for
|
||||||
|
matrix and vector operations.
|
||||||
|
* - `hipBLASLt <https://github.com/ROCm/hipBLASLt>`_
|
||||||
|
- :version-ref:`hipBLASLt rocm_version`
|
||||||
|
- hipBLASLt is an extension of the hipBLAS library, providing additional
|
||||||
|
features like epilogues fused into the matrix multiplication kernel or
|
||||||
|
use of integer tensor cores.
|
||||||
|
* - `hipCUB <https://github.com/ROCm/hipCUB>`_
|
||||||
|
- :version-ref:`hipCUB rocm_version`
|
||||||
|
- Provides a C++ template library for parallel algorithms for reduction,
|
||||||
|
scan, sort and select.
|
||||||
|
* - `hipFFT <https://github.com/ROCm/hipFFT>`_
|
||||||
|
- :version-ref:`hipFFT rocm_version`
|
||||||
|
- Provides GPU-accelerated Fast Fourier Transform (FFT) operations.
|
||||||
|
* - `hipRAND <https://github.com/ROCm/hipRAND>`_
|
||||||
|
- :version-ref:`hipRAND rocm_version`
|
||||||
|
- Provides fast random number generation for GPUs.
|
||||||
|
* - `hipSOLVER <https://github.com/ROCm/hipSOLVER>`_
|
||||||
|
- :version-ref:`hipSOLVER rocm_version`
|
||||||
|
- Provides GPU-accelerated solvers for linear systems, eigenvalues, and
|
||||||
|
singular value decompositions (SVD).
|
||||||
|
* - `hipSPARSE <https://github.com/ROCm/hipSPARSE>`_
|
||||||
|
- :version-ref:`hipSPARSE rocm_version`
|
||||||
|
- Accelerates operations on sparse matrices, such as sparse matrix-vector
|
||||||
|
or matrix-matrix products.
|
||||||
|
* - `hipSPARSELt <https://github.com/ROCm/hipSPARSELt>`_
|
||||||
|
- :version-ref:`hipSPARSELt rocm_version`
|
||||||
|
- Accelerates operations on sparse matrices, such as sparse matrix-vector
|
||||||
|
or matrix-matrix products.
|
||||||
|
* - `hipTensor <https://github.com/ROCm/hipTensor>`_
|
||||||
|
- :version-ref:`hipTensor rocm_version`
|
||||||
|
- Optimizes for high-performance tensor operations, such as contractions.
|
||||||
|
* - `MIOpen <https://github.com/ROCm/MIOpen>`_
|
||||||
|
- :version-ref:`MIOpen rocm_version`
|
||||||
|
- Optimizes deep learning primitives such as convolutions, pooling,
|
||||||
|
normalization, and activation functions.
|
||||||
|
* - `MIGraphX <https://github.com/ROCm/AMDMIGraphX>`_
|
||||||
|
- :version-ref:`MIGraphX rocm_version`
|
||||||
|
- Adds graph-level optimizations, ONNX models and mixed precision support
|
||||||
|
and enable Ahead-of-Time (AOT) Compilation.
|
||||||
|
* - `MIVisionX <https://github.com/ROCm/MIVisionX>`_
|
||||||
|
- :version-ref:`MIVisionX rocm_version`
|
||||||
|
- Optimizes acceleration for computer vision and AI workloads like
|
||||||
|
preprocessing, augmentation, and inferencing.
|
||||||
|
* - `rocAL <https://github.com/ROCm/rocAL>`_
|
||||||
|
- :version-ref:`rocAL rocm_version`
|
||||||
|
- Accelerates the data pipeline by offloading intensive preprocessing and
|
||||||
|
augmentation tasks. rocAL is part of MIVisionX.
|
||||||
|
* - `RCCL <https://github.com/ROCm/rccl>`_
|
||||||
|
- :version-ref:`RCCL rocm_version`
|
||||||
|
- Optimizes for multi-GPU communication for operations like AllReduce and
|
||||||
|
Broadcast.
|
||||||
|
* - `rocDecode <https://github.com/ROCm/rocDecode>`_
|
||||||
|
- :version-ref:`rocDecode rocm_version`
|
||||||
|
- Provides hardware-accelerated data decoding capabilities, particularly
|
||||||
|
for image, video, and other dataset formats.
|
||||||
|
* - `rocJPEG <https://github.com/ROCm/rocJPEG>`_
|
||||||
|
- :version-ref:`rocJPEG rocm_version`
|
||||||
|
- Provides hardware-accelerated JPEG image decoding and encoding.
|
||||||
|
* - `RPP <https://github.com/ROCm/RPP>`_
|
||||||
|
- :version-ref:`RPP rocm_version`
|
||||||
|
- Speeds up data augmentation, transformation, and other preprocessing steps.
|
||||||
|
* - `rocThrust <https://github.com/ROCm/rocThrust>`_
|
||||||
|
- :version-ref:`rocThrust rocm_version`
|
||||||
|
- Provides a C++ template library for parallel algorithms like sorting,
|
||||||
|
reduction, and scanning.
|
||||||
|
* - `rocWMMA <https://github.com/ROCm/rocWMMA>`_
|
||||||
|
- :version-ref:`rocWMMA rocm_version`
|
||||||
|
- Accelerates warp-level matrix-multiply and matrix-accumulate to speed up matrix
|
||||||
|
multiplication (GEMM) and accumulation operations with mixed precision
|
||||||
|
support.
|
